If a steady current I is flowing through a cylindrical element ABC. Choose the correct relationship

A

`V_(AB) = 2V_(BC)`

B

power across BC is 4 times the power across AB.

C

Current densities in AB and BC are equal.

D

Electric field due to current inside AB and BC are equal

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B

(b)
(a) V_(AB)/V_(BC) = (I_(AB)R_(AB))/(I_(BC)R_(BC)) = R_(AB)/R_(BC) = (rho l/(2[pi xx 4r^2]))/(rhol/(2[pir^2])) = 1/4`
`[I_(AB) = I_(BC), wire is of same material ]
Therefore option (a) is incorrect.
(b) `P_(BC)/P_(AB) = (I^2R_(BC))/(I^2R_(AB)) = (rho l/(2[pi xx 4r^2]))/(rhol/(2[pir^2])) = 1/4 `
`:. P_(AB) = 4P_(BC) , Therefore (b) is correct.
(c) J_(AB)/J_(BC) = (I/(pi xx 4r^2)) /(I/(pi xx r^2)) = 1/4 `, Therefore (c) is incorrect.
(d) `E_(AB)/E_(BC) = [(V_(AB)/(l//2))]/[(V_(BC)/l//2)] = 1/4`, Therefore (d) id incorrect.
